Run it on your computer

Local is a setup choice, not a magic privacy shield.

Local is a setup choice, not a magic privacy shield.

A local runner such as LM Studio can keep prompts away from a hosted model service. Downloads, updates, extensions, backups, and the rest of your computer still matter. Cloud features and “improve the product” toggles can send text off-machine after all.

  1. 01

    Install LM Studio (or a similar runner)

    A graphical app. You do not start in the terminal.

  2. 02

    Pick a small instruct model

    Read the model card and the license. Open-weight is not automatically open-license.

  3. 03

    Download a quantized file that fits

    Quantization shrinks the weight file so a laptop can hold it. Quality drops as the file gets smaller.

  4. 04

    Turn off remote fallbacks

    Then test with made-up information before you type anything you care about.
